Abstract

The combination of accelerator technology and merged-beams techniques in storage ring experiments has opened up new experimental opportunities for electron-ion collision studies. In particular, charge changing electron-ion interactions at energies reaching from keV down to μeV with meV (and lower) electron beam temperatures have become accessible with ions of almost all charge states between H- and U92+. Examples of recombination and ionization measurements are presented and specific issues such as interference effects, high-resolution spectroscopy and rate enhancements in the presence of external fields are discussed.
